Output 51df8c0261f6ee8dfc00419f45ba775514dbcf48dfb31f640019b34aa8e4cdb3:1

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ae22d229d283efd1f4a32ea9ff69f5c9137c41e OP_EQUAL
address
3CtmJxCcmibdEdgcXhycWr8SPr9oA9ibDk
transaction
51df8c0261f6ee8dfc00419f45ba775514dbcf48dfb31f640019b34aa8e4cdb3
spent
true